To prepare for the SSC CHSL (Combined Higher Secondary Level) exam, follow these steps:
1. Understand the Exam Pattern and Syllabus
Tier | Test Type | Total Questions / Duration | Topics |
---|---|---|---|
Tier I | Computer-Based Test (CBT) | 200 questions, 1-hour duration | – General Intelligence and Reasoning: 25 questions |
– General Awareness: 25 questions | |||
– Quantitative Aptitude: 25 questions | |||
– English Comprehension: 25 questions | |||
Tier II | Descriptive Paper | Essay and Letter Writing | Writing an essay and letter on a given topic |
Tier III | Skill Test / Typing Test | Based on the post | Typing or skill-related tasks (depending on the post) |

3. Section-Wise Preparation
Section | Preparation Tips |
---|---|
General Intelligence & Reasoning | – Practice puzzles, analogies, and seating arrangements. |
– Use mock tests to improve speed and accuracy. | |
General Awareness | – Read newspapers daily to stay updated with current events. |
– Follow current affairs, history, geography, economy, and politics. | |
Quantitative Aptitude | – Focus on arithmetic, algebra, and geometry. |
– Regular practice of topics like time and work, simple interest, and percentage. | |
English Comprehension | – Improve vocabulary by reading books and articles. |
– Practice grammar, sentence completion, and reading comprehension exercises. |
